OB中用“git add .”命令,报了这个错误这是什么问题呀?

OB中用“git add .”命令,报了这个错误这是什么问题呀?lALPJxRxTO2SIddlzQMs_812_101.png

展开
收起
fuxixi 2022-10-17 13:28:57 534 分享 版权
阿里云 AI 助理回答
  1. 问题描述: 您在OB(可能是操作宝、OpenBuildService等的简称)中使用git add .命令时遇到了错误。

  2. 解决步骤

    • 检查错误信息:首先,请仔细查看终端返回的具体错误消息,这通常是解决问题的关键。常见的错误可能包括文件权限问题、路径错误或Git配置不当等。

    • 文件权限问题:如果错误与权限相关,确保当前用户对工作目录中的所有文件有读取权限。可以尝试用以下命令修复权限(谨慎操作,尤其是生产环境):

      chmod -R a+rwx .
      
    • Git配置确认:确认Git是否正确配置了用户信息,这虽然不直接影响git add命令,但良好的配置习惯有助于避免后续提交时的问题。使用以下命令检查和设置:

      git config --global user.name "Your Name"
      git config --global user.email "you@example.com"
      
    • 清理并重试:如果上述步骤不能解决问题,尝试清理Git的索引锁文件,有时候进程异常退出可能导致锁文件残留。

      rm -f ./.git/index.lock
      git add .
      
  3. 注意事项

    • 避免全局写权限:上述chmod命令给予了所有文件过宽的权限,仅在明确是权限问题且了解风险的情况下使用。生产环境中应严格控制权限。
    • 具体问题具体分析:根据错误提示采取行动,不同的错误信息对应不同的解决方案。

由于提供的参考资料未直接涉及该特定错误,以上建议基于常见Git使用中遇到的问题和解决策略。如果问题依然存在,建议直接提供错误信息以便进行更精确的诊断。

有帮助
无帮助
AI 助理回答生成答案可能存在不准确,仅供参考
0 条回答
写回答
取消 提交回答
问答分类:
问答地址:

数据库领域前沿技术分享与交流

收录在圈子:
+ 订阅
让用户数据永远在线,让数据无缝的自由流动
还有其他疑问?
咨询AI助理